Officially a working Mum!

Started working on 3rd Jan & before the week ended, I was feeling so tired. Really not easy being a full time working mum while breastfeeding.

Our typical routine goes like this..
- Wake up at 5+ for early am pump followed by morning workout (jog or weights training).
- Wake baby Kara up at 6.45am for her latch-on breakfast followed by her morning bathe.
- My shower & prep while daddy "entertain" baby Kara.
- Gerald will leave house earlier ard 8am while I'll latch-on baby Kara for another 15mins before dropping baby Kara & our helper at either my mum's or in-laws house.

By the time I reach office on the 2nd day, I was already tired. :(
Not too busy this week but the 2 pump sessions during office hours were already a hassle.

By the 4th day, I'm already missing my pumping session due to extended meetings and having to eat packed lunch to catch up with the pumping.


Rushing to drop & pick up baby Kara amidst the heavy traffic also adds on to the stress.

Despite these challenges, looking forward to playing with Baby Kara at night.


Luckily baby Kara is real smiley & her smile melt our hearts.
